Investing in the stock market can be a daunting task, especially for beginners. However, by joining a team stock investment group, you can leverage the collective knowledge and experience of your peers to make informed decisions. In this article, we'll explore the concept of team stock, its benefits, and how to get started.

What is Team Stock?

Team stock refers to a group of individuals who pool their resources to invest in the stock market. Each member contributes a certain amount of money, and the group decides how to allocate those funds. This collaborative approach allows members to share research, insights, and risk, making it an attractive option for those new to investing.

Benefits of Team Stock

  • Shared Knowledge: By pooling resources, team members can share their expertise and research, leading to more informed investment decisions.
  • Risk Diversification: Investing in a variety of stocks can help mitigate risk. Team stock allows members to diversify their portfolios without having to invest large sums of money individually.
  • Networking Opportunities: Joining a team stock group can help you build valuable connections with like-minded individuals.
  • Educational Experience: Learning from others' experiences can help you develop your own investment strategy and improve your financial literacy.

How to Get Started

  1. Find a Team Stock Group: Look for local or online groups that align with your investment goals and risk tolerance. Websites like Meetup.com and Reddit can be great resources for finding team stock groups.
  2. Define Your Investment Strategy: Before joining a group, decide on your investment goals and risk tolerance. This will help you find a group that aligns with your values.
  3. Contribute Regularly: Consistency is key in team stock investing. Make sure to contribute your share of the funds regularly to ensure the group's success.
  4. Participate in Discussions: Actively engage in discussions and share your insights with the group. This will help you build relationships and learn from others.
  5. Stay Informed: Keep up with market trends and financial news to make informed decisions.
